How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 20724?

20724 apartments
Bed Type Average Rent Range
1BR $1,580 $1,550 - $2,140
2BR $1,930 $1,850 - $2,490
3BR $3,500 $2,400 - $3,800

Looking for apartments for rent in 20724 Laurel, MD? Rentable has rental information for this area. Currently, there are 76 units available for rent in the 20724 zip code. The average rent in this area is $2,300, with the lowest rent for a 1-bedroom floor plan starting at $1,542.

For those interested in outdoor activities, there are several parks near the 20724 zip code. Take a stroll through Granville Gude Park and Lakehouse, which offers beautiful walking trails and a lake for boating and fishing. If you enjoy golf, the Patuxent Greens Golf Club is just a short drive away.

Apartment seekers looking for a convenient location will appreciate the proximity of the 20724 zip code to major highways and public transportation. With easy access to Route 1 and Interstate 95, commuting to nearby cities like Washington, D.C. and Baltimore is a breeze.

Methodology

Each month, using over 1 million Rentable listings across the United States, we calculate the median 1-bedroom and 2-bedroom rent prices by city, state, and nation, and track the month-over-month percent change. To avoid small sample sizes, we restrict the analysis for our reports to cities meeting minimum population and property count thresholds.
